Todd Cahoon portrays ex-military
special-operative, Jack Porter in
"Watch Over Me." Jack is hired to
protect Julia (Dayanara Torres) and
Caroline (Caitlin McCarthy), the
girlfriend and daughter
(respectively) of multi-millionaire
Michael Krieger (Marc Menard).
Jack's allegiance to Michael is
broken when he falls in love with
Julia, and when he discovers that
Michael is involved in a conspiracy
that could threaten the lives of
millions.
A native of Rochester, New York,
Cahoon fell in love with acting when
his high school sweetheart convinced
him to take drama classes in high
school. He pursued acting throughout
college and followed his passion to
Hollywood. Cahoon has appeared in
numerous television shows including
"Zoey 101," with Jamie Lynn Spears;
"Without a Trace," "Charmed" and
"Modern Men." His film credits
include roles in "Ladder 49,"
starring Joaquin Phoenix and John
Travolta; "Escape Under Pressure,"
with Rob Lowe; "Bob Steel"; and the
soon to be released "Poughkeepsie
Tapes." Recently, Cahoon has gone
back to his stage roots and
performed at the Stella Adler
Theatre in the Broadway hit drama
"The First Breeze of Summer"
directed by Sam Nickens.
